Responsibilities

* Develop, implement, and maintain health and safety policies and procedures in compliance with legal requirements.

* Conduct regular risk assessments and audits to identify potential hazards and recommend corrective actions.

* Provide training and support to staff on health and safety practices, ensuring that all employees are aware of their responsibilities.

* Monitor workplace conditions and ensure compliance with health and safety standards.

* Investigate incidents, accidents, and near misses, preparing detailed reports with recommendations for improvement.

* Implementing improved process using the businesses in house IT system

* Liaise with regulatory bodies, ensuring that the organisation remains compliant with all relevant legislation.

* Promote a proactive health and safety culture within the organisation through effective communication and engagement strategies.
